Job description

About our client

Our client manages a large residential leasehold portfolio across England and Wales, acting as a long-term steward for the homes in its care. They're a close-knit team who take pride in delivering a high standard of service, supported by good technology and a collaborative, friendly culture. It's a smaller business backed by a much larger group, so you get variety and a tight team with real stability.

The role

Reporting to the Estate Manager, you'll be the engine room of the estates function. You'll keep records, systems and trackers in order, prepare and issue reports and documents, manage a busy shared inbox, and help keep the portfolio compliant day to day. It blends administration, coordination and customer contact, so you'll need to juggle priorities and stay on top of detail in a fast-moving environment. It's a fully office-based role in Borehamwood.
